TensorFlow?通過優化的開源SYCL?庫獲得對PowerVR? GPU的原生支持

winniewei 提交于 周四, 10/24/2019
TensorFlow?通過優化的開源SYCL?庫獲得對PowerVR? GPU的原生支持

開源的SYCL神經網絡庫已針對PowerVR進行了優化,通過攜手Codeplay使開發人員可以更輕松地移植現有代碼

英國倫敦和美國圣克拉拉,2019年10月23日——Imagination Technologies宣布:得益于全新優化的開源SYCL神經網絡庫,使用TensorFlow的開發人員將可以直接面向PowerVR圖形處理器(GPU)進行開發。其首個版本將在2019年提供商用。

TensorFlow的SYCL版本支持大量的人工智能(AI)操作(如圖1),并且用戶也易于去按需定制,這意味著開發人員通過使用最新的神經網絡或他們自己研究的AI技術,就可以在PowerVR上運行那些即刻可用的高性能網絡。由于TensorFlow SYCL的支持既是開源的又是基于開放標準的,因此對于那些想要在低功耗設備上對最新的AI技術進行加速的開發人員而言,它是一種理想的解決方案。

1

圖1——由SYCL提供支持的TensorFlow操作

SYCL是一種無需支付版稅的、可替代CUDA架構的開放標準方案,它打破了生態系統之間的壁壘,從而為開發人員提供更多自由,去采用標準的C ++來編寫代碼、去釋放GPU硬件的性能優勢并確保代碼的可移植性。

此外,Codeplay的SYCL庫支持應用去無縫地利用為IMGDNN PowerVR優化的應用程序接口(API)。 IMGDNN是Imagination的專有神經網絡圖形編譯庫,它可幫助開發人員從PowerVR GPU和神經網絡加速器(NNA)中獲得最高性能。

這個新擴展的生態系統可應用的主要市場包括:汽車、數據中心和智能攝像頭。

Imagination Technologies產品管理高級總監Neal Forse表示:“在一個開放標準框架內工作可使開發人員放心,他們的代碼不會過時或者需要重寫。 通過SYCL可以訪問已被廣泛使用的PowerVR GPU,開發人員將可以在TensorFlow下輕松取得強大的計算資源。”

Codeplay首席執行官Andrew Richards說道:“現在,我們看到SYCL標準的市場應用已實現了巨大的增長。瑞薩電子(Renesas)在其R-Car汽車AI平臺上啟用了SYCL,現在英特爾也將SYCL納入其One API中。通過提高標準化程度來對諸如PowerVR GPU這類高性能加速器進行編程,將使AI軟件開發人員能夠將高級智能帶入萬物之中,包括從微型低功耗電池驅動設備到大型超級計算機。”

SYCL建立在Khronos OpenCL?的概念和效率之上。包括SYCL-DNNSYCL-BLAS?Eigen為PowerVR優化的SYCL庫將可以在GitHub上提供。包含已擴展的SYCL支持的TensorFlow分支可從Codeplay的GitHub獲得。

關于Codeplay軟件公司

Codeplay軟件有限公司是AI加速技術領域內的世界先驅,公司已開發了一些先期工具來使諸如AI等復雜的軟件能夠通過使用圖形處理器而被加速。 如今,包括用于汽車的軟件產品在內的大多數AI軟件都在采用專為視頻游戲設計的圖形處理器來開發。Codeplay是全球領先的工具提供商,所提供的工具可通過圖形處理器或最新的專用AI處理器來使軟件得到加速。 Codeplay與全球領先的技術企業合作,將先進的智能部署到從智能手機到自動駕駛汽車的各種設備中。

關于Imagination Technologies

Imagination是一家總部位于英國的公司,致力于打造半導體和軟件知識產權(IP),為其客戶在競爭激烈的全球技術市場中提供優勢。公司的圖形、計算、視覺和人工智能以及連接技術可以實現出眾的功率、性能和面積PPA強大的安全性快速的上市時間和更低的總體擁有成本(TCO)。基于Imagination IP的產品被全球數十億人用于他們的手機、汽車、住宅和工作場所。Imagination Technologies于2017年被全球私募股權投資基金Canyon Bridge收購。更多信息,請訪問www.imgtec.com

相關文章

Digi-Key